Php 4:8-9  Finally, brothers and sisters, whatever is true, whatever is noble, whatever is right, whatever is pure, whatever is lovely, whatever is admirable–if anything is excellent or praiseworthy–think about such things.  (9)  Whatever you have learned or received or heard from me, or seen in me–put it into practice. And the God of peace will be with you. The Christian life involves proper thinking (what is true, noble, right, praiseworthy, lovely, admirable), but it also includes doing righteous deeds. Since the Philippians knew Paul well, he could ask them to follow his example. They had learned… received and heard from him, and they had even seen the apostle’s conduct. As they put these things (from Paul’s teaching and living) into practice, they would enjoy the presence of the God of peace.
